Skip site navigation (1)Skip section navigation (2)
Date:      Thu, 27 Apr 2023 08:36:54 GMT
From:      Yuri Victorovich <yuri@FreeBSD.org>
To:        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org
Subject:   git: 9cad713f22e9 - main - =?utf-8?Q?cad/surelog:=20Update=201.56=20=E2=86=92=201.57?=
Message-ID:  <202304270836.33R8asQq000572@gitrepo.freebsd.org>

next in thread | raw e-mail | index | archive | help
The branch main has been updated by yuri:

URL: https://cgit.FreeBSD.org/ports/commit/?id=9cad713f22e9b457f40ac86f0335c43833d00267

commit 9cad713f22e9b457f40ac86f0335c43833d00267
Author:     Yuri Victorovich <yuri@FreeBSD.org>
AuthorDate: 2023-04-27 06:41:45 +0000
Commit:     Yuri Victorovich <yuri@FreeBSD.org>
CommitDate: 2023-04-27 08:36:48 +0000

    cad/surelog: Update 1.56 → 1.57
    
    Reported by:    portscout
---
 cad/surelog/Makefile                   |  8 ++++----
 cad/surelog/distinfo                   | 18 +++++++++---------
 cad/surelog/files/patch-CMakeLists.txt | 24 ++++++++++++++++--------
 3 files changed, 29 insertions(+), 21 deletions(-)

diff --git a/cad/surelog/Makefile b/cad/surelog/Makefile
index cbd8b17df190..22926892a425 100644
--- a/cad/surelog/Makefile
+++ b/cad/surelog/Makefile
@@ -1,6 +1,6 @@
 PORTNAME=	surelog
 DISTVERSIONPREFIX=	v
-DISTVERSION=	1.56
+DISTVERSION=	1.57
 CATEGORIES=	cad
 
 MAINTAINER=	yuri@FreeBSD.org
@@ -27,9 +27,9 @@ USE_LDCONFIG=	${PREFIX}/lib ${PREFIX}/lib/surelog
 USE_GITHUB=	yes
 GH_ACCOUNT=	chipsalliance
 GH_PROJECT=	Surelog
-GH_TUPLE=	alainmarcel:antlr4:3143e88:antlr4/third_party/antlr4 \
-		google:googletest:e1ee0fa:googletest/third_party/googletest \
-		google:flatbuffers:32a6744:flatbuffers/third_party/flatbuffers
+GH_TUPLE=	alainmarcel:antlr4:2406774:antlr4/third_party/antlr4 \
+		google:googletest:dea0484:googletest/third_party/googletest \
+		google:flatbuffers:6eae49a:flatbuffers/third_party/flatbuffers
 
 CMAKE_ON=	BUILD_SHARED_LIBS SURELOG_USE_HOST_UHDM
 CMAKE_OFF=	SURELOG_BUILD_TESTS
diff --git a/cad/surelog/distinfo b/cad/surelog/distinfo
index 58193bf0aedb..1e2b3147f677 100644
--- a/cad/surelog/distinfo
+++ b/cad/surelog/distinfo
@@ -1,9 +1,9 @@
-TIMESTAMP = 1681668095
-SHA256 (chipsalliance-Surelog-v1.56_GH0.tar.gz) = 36396d327aa4d433b38e0673608316e25f696e0d37c5f2ce14976b71a24f0683
-SIZE (chipsalliance-Surelog-v1.56_GH0.tar.gz) = 91906822
-SHA256 (alainmarcel-antlr4-3143e88_GH0.tar.gz) = cc950334f511b91b9b47bc8b84b60a7f7ae85d3ab2cb7a8596a9a226a53386ce
-SIZE (alainmarcel-antlr4-3143e88_GH0.tar.gz) = 4310506
-SHA256 (google-googletest-e1ee0fa_GH0.tar.gz) = d2d59b967237e554f5d816892b4aa831ed024d3af7ffcfde1e232260a19d4501
-SIZE (google-googletest-e1ee0fa_GH0.tar.gz) = 865239
-SHA256 (google-flatbuffers-32a6744_GH0.tar.gz) = 826bb0eb96e79a909592c9fb4c4ef775d61a0b4c30e9db0249ff924830cf3cf7
-SIZE (google-flatbuffers-32a6744_GH0.tar.gz) = 2198497
+TIMESTAMP = 1682575094
+SHA256 (chipsalliance-Surelog-v1.57_GH0.tar.gz) = d114afc9eb121e310214324ecef9d6959dee754474ee6ac6f4c4a489360b58ae
+SIZE (chipsalliance-Surelog-v1.57_GH0.tar.gz) = 91932475
+SHA256 (alainmarcel-antlr4-2406774_GH0.tar.gz) = 47c777fe91a0533fa24600bd2cf44328a8811e638d3fb8a76b89b6c96b65d023
+SIZE (alainmarcel-antlr4-2406774_GH0.tar.gz) = 4312960
+SHA256 (google-googletest-dea0484_GH0.tar.gz) = de1bde669e89841b71dbad128a37a8678981941138653941f4a1453638af6609
+SIZE (google-googletest-dea0484_GH0.tar.gz) = 867311
+SHA256 (google-flatbuffers-6eae49a_GH0.tar.gz) = f2acb5069cc0509f7e234664806a869c2f385f0a81540126473db79ee1167991
+SIZE (google-flatbuffers-6eae49a_GH0.tar.gz) = 2214541
diff --git a/cad/surelog/files/patch-CMakeLists.txt b/cad/surelog/files/patch-CMakeLists.txt
index 4fb99220f363..530c39f79b1d 100644
--- a/cad/surelog/files/patch-CMakeLists.txt
+++ b/cad/surelog/files/patch-CMakeLists.txt
@@ -1,20 +1,28 @@
---- CMakeLists.txt.orig	2022-08-20 02:45:49 UTC
+--- CMakeLists.txt.orig	2023-04-25 18:21:08 UTC
 +++ CMakeLists.txt
-@@ -53,7 +53,7 @@ set(GENDIR ${CMAKE_CURRENT_BINARY_DIR}/generated)
+@@ -141,14 +141,14 @@ set(CMAKE_RUNTIME_OUTPUT_DIRECTORY ${CMAKE_CURRENT_BIN
  
  # Python
  if (SURELOG_WITH_PYTHON)
--  find_package(Python3 3.3 REQUIRED COMPONENTS Interpreter Development)
+-  find_package(Python3 REQUIRED COMPONENTS Interpreter Development)
 +  find_package(Python3 ${FREEBSD_PYTHON_DISTVERSION} EXACT REQUIRED COMPONENTS Interpreter Development)
-   find_package(SWIG 3.0 REQUIRED)
+   find_package(SWIG REQUIRED)
    message(STATUS "Python3_LIBRARIES = ${Python3_LIBRARIES}")
    message(STATUS "Python3_EXECUTABLE = ${Python3_EXECUTABLE}")
-@@ -140,7 +140,7 @@ add_custom_command(
-           ${FLATBUFFERS_FLATC_EXECUTABLE})
+   message(STATUS "Python3_INCLUDE_DIRS = ${Python3_INCLUDE_DIRS}")
+   message(STATUS "Python3_RUNTIME_LIBRARY_DIRS = ${Python3_RUNTIME_LIBRARY_DIRS}")
+ else()
+-  find_package(Python3 3.3 REQUIRED Interpreter)
++  find_package(Python3 ${FREEBSD_PYTHON_DISTVERSION} EXACT REQUIRED Interpreter)
+   message(STATUS "Python3_EXECUTABLE = ${Python3_EXECUTABLE}")
+ endif()
+ 
+@@ -231,7 +231,7 @@ add_custom_command(
+           ${PROJECT_SOURCE_DIR}/src/Cache/preproc.fbs)
  
  # Java
 -find_package(Java 11 REQUIRED COMPONENTS Runtime)
 +find_package(Java ${FREEBSD_JAVA_VERSION} REQUIRED COMPONENTS Runtime)
  message(STATUS "Java_JAVA_EXECUTABLE = ${Java_JAVA_EXECUTABLE}")
- set(ANTLR_JAR_LOCATION
-     ${PROJECT_SOURCE_DIR}/third_party/antlr4_bin/antlr-4.10-complete.jar)
+ 
+ add_custom_target(GenerateParser DEPENDS



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?202304270836.33R8asQq000572>